Welcome to ShenZhenJia Knowledge Sharing Community for programmer and developer-Open, Learning and Share
menu search
person
Welcome To Ask or Share your Answers For Others

Categories


与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…
thumb_up_alt 0 like thumb_down_alt 0 dislike
798 views
Welcome To Ask or Share your Answers For Others

1 Answer

If you are coming from a MVC background then Play will feel the most familiar. Lift is not MVC and it takes some time to wrap your head around it.

There is no reason that you can't use Scala with a Java-based framework like Jersey, Spring MVC, Dropwizard, Restlet, RESTEasy, etc. Or you could use Scala with Grails just like you can use Java with Grails. Note - Groovy has type safety starting with version 2.0 so that's something to consider.

If you are thinking about Scalatra then don't forget Spray, Unfiltered, BlueEyes...

Be sure to check out Matt Raible's comprehensive comparison of web frameworks. And these other SO questions: Scala framework for a Rest API Server?, How to implement a REST Web Service using Akka?


与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…
thumb_up_alt 0 like thumb_down_alt 0 dislike
Welcome to ShenZhenJia Knowledge Sharing Community for programmer and developer-Open, Learning and Share
...